USGS Streamgage 06285100

Shoshone River near Lovell, WY

Shoshone River near Lovell, WY is USGS streamgage 06285100 in Wyoming, monitoring river discharge in hydrologic subbasin 10080014. It drains a watershed of about 2,390 square miles. Discharge records at this site go back to 1966. Typical flow runs near 1,125.7 cfs in July and 582 cfs in April, with the higher of the two arriving in July. Typical flow by month

Long-term daily discharge percentiles from the USGS record (up to 60 years of data), averaged within each month. These describe the historical normal range — they are not a forecast and not today's reading.

Historical monthly discharge percentiles in cubic feet per second
Month Low p10 Typical p50 High p90 Range
January 303.2 529.9 811.1
February 309 547.2 897.1
March 300.1 558.8 1,139.4
April 253.7 582 2,482
May 297.1 626.5 2,640.6
June 376.2 1,437.6 4,916.7
July 293.8 1,125.7 3,916.1
August 399.9 674.5 1,163.9
September 481.3 737.7 1,274.3
October 433 724.6 1,162.6
November 404.7 639.5 1,065.5
December 344.3 568 961.1

All values in cubic feet per second (cfs).

When does Shoshone River near Lovell, WY normally run highest?
June, on the long-term record. The median daily flow that month is about 1,437.6 cfs, against 529.9 cfs in January, the lowest month. These are historical normals for the date, not a forecast and not today's reading.
What is a normal flow for Shoshone River near Lovell, WY?
It depends on the month. In January, half of days historically fall near 529.9 cfs, with the middle 80% of days between 303.2 and 811.1 cfs. The month-by-month table on this page gives the full range.
How long has Shoshone River near Lovell, WY been measured?
Discharge records at USGS site 06285100 begin in 1966, about 60 years, covering roughly 9,199 days of published daily values. The long record is what makes the monthly percentiles on this page meaningful.
